RBI’s net short forward position hits record $106.6 billion amid rupee pressure

19 hours ago

The Reserve Bank of India's intervention to shield the rupee from volatility, fueled by Middle East tensions, has widened its net short forward position to a record $106.6 billion. Despite a recent dip to a historic low, the rupee has shown recovery, buoyed by anticipated foreign capital inflows. These expected inflows are seen as a potential avenue for the RBI to reduce its forward position and bolster foreign exchange reserves.
